MongoDB一种非关系型的数据库,它并不是内存数据库。它将数据存储在磁盘上,但也可以选择将一部分数据加载到内存中以提高查询性能。 接下来,我将为你介绍MongoDB不是内存数据库的原因,并为你提供实现MongoDB的步骤和相关代码。 首先,让我们来看一下如何使用MongoDB的流程: ```mermaid flowchart TD A(连接到MongoDB) --> B(选择数据库) B
原创 2024-01-24 09:55:45
211阅读
# 如何实现“MongoDB国产数据库”的查询 MongoDB 一个 NoSQL 数据库,广泛用于大数据处理和实时分析。尽管许多人使用 MongoDB,但是它的来源和国籍常常引发讨论。在这篇文章中,我们将指导一位刚入行的小白如何确认 MongoDB 是否国产数据库。我们的目标通过构建一个简单的应用接口来为这个问题提供答案。 ## 整体流程 为了解释我们要做的事情,以下整个流程的概
原创 10月前
152阅读
## MongoDB 国产数据库? 在现代应用程序开发中,数据库技术的发展日新月异。其中,MongoDB 一种广泛应用的 NoSQL 数据库。许多人关心 MongoDB 是否国产数据库。本文将对此进行探讨,并介绍 MongoDB 的基本概念、使用示例以及它在国内和国际上的影响力。\ ### 什么 MongoDBMongoDB 一个基于文档的 NoSQL 数据库,凭借其灵活的数
原创 8月前
163阅读
概述mongodb一个开源的,基于分布式的,面向文档存储的非关系型数据库,是非关系型数据库当中功能最丰富、最像关系数据库的由C++语言编写的,使用JavaScript作为操作语言,一个基于分布式文件存储的开源数据库系统将数据存储为一个文档,数据结构由键值(key=>value)对组成。MongoDB 文档类似于 JSON 对象。字段值可以包含其他文档,数组及文档数组非关系型的数据库即NoS
与关系型数据库相比,MongoDB的优点:①弱一致性(最终一致),更能保证用户的访问速度:举例来说,在传统的关系型数据库中,一个COUNT类型的操作会锁定数据集,这样可以保证得到“当前”情况下的精确值。这在某些情况下,例 如通过ATM查看账户信息的时候很重要,但对于Wordnik来说,数据不断更新和增长的,这种“精确”的保证几乎没有任何意义,反而会产生很大的延 迟。他们需要的一个“大约”的数
1. 数据库模式三级模式:外模式对应视图,模式(也称为概念模式)对应数据库表,内模式对应物理文件。两层映像:外模式-模式映像,模式-内模式映像;两层映像可以保证数据库中的数据具有较高的逻辑独立性和物理独立性逻辑独立性:即逻辑结构发生改变时,用户程序对外模式的调用可以不做修改;物理独立性:即数据库的内模式发生改变时,数据的逻辑结构不变。2.E-R 模型E-R图各元素的定义:实体:用矩形表示,现实世
MongoDB介绍MongoDB一个C++语言编写的开源NoSQL数据库,目的为Web应用程序提供高性能、高可用性且易于扩展的数据存储解决方案。MongoDBNoSQL数据库中最热门的一种,一种文档型数据库MongoDB易于扩展,表结构自由,高性能。官网:https://www.mongodb.com/MongoDB历史关系型数据库在很长时间里一直数据库领域当之无愧的王者,例如MySQ
MongoDB 一个基于分布式文件存储的数据库。由 C++ 语言编写。旨在为 WEB 应用提供可扩展的高性能数据存储解决方案。MongoDB 一个介于关系数据库和非关系数据库之间的产品,是非关系数据库当中功能最丰富,最像关系数据库的。1、NoSQL 简介NoSQL(NoSQL = Not Only SQL ),意即”不仅仅是SQL”。 在现代的计算系统上每天网络上都会产生庞大的数据量。 这
首先给两个MongoDB的学习地址:www.runoob.com/mongodb/mongodb-windows-install.htmlMongoDB一个基于分布式文件存储的数据库。c++编写。为web应用提供可扩展的高性能数据存储解决方案。MongoDB一个介于关系数据库和非关系数据库之间的产品,是非关系数据库中功能最丰富,最像关系数据库的。NoSQL(Not Only SQL)不仅仅是S
# MongoDB关系型数据库? 作为一名经验丰富的开发者,我很乐意教会那些刚入行的小白关于数据库的知识。在这篇文章中,我将教你如何实现“MongoDB关系型数据库”的问题。 ## 步骤 首先让我们来看看整个流程的步骤: | 步骤 | 描述 | | ---- | ---- | | 1 | 安装MongoDB | | 2 | 连接MongoDB | | 3 | 创建一个数据库 | |
原创 2024-07-02 04:23:02
44阅读
# MongoDB纯内存数据库? 在讨论MongoDB是否为纯内存数据库之前,我们先来了解一下什么纯内存数据库。纯内存数据库数据库完全驻留在内存中,所有数据都存储在内存中,不需要持久化到磁盘。这样可以提高数据的读写速度,但也会受限于内存大小。 而MongoDB一个面向文档的数据库管理系统,它使用JSON风格的文档来存储数据,支持丰富的查询操作和数据处理能力。MongoDB支持将数据
原创 2024-03-29 06:24:39
107阅读
>>MemcachedMemcached的优点:Memcached可以利用多核优势,单实例吞吐量极高,可以达到几十万QPS(取决于key、value的字节大小以及服务器硬件性能,日常环境中QPS高峰大约在4-6w左右)。适用于最大程度扛量。支持直接配置为session handle。Memcached的局限性:只支持简单的key/value数据结构,不像Redis可以支持丰富的数据类型
根据 PostgreSQL 在 2018 年的数据库排名,它比其他监测到的 343 个数据库管理系统都更受欢迎。因此,决定宣布 PostgreSQL 为 2018 年的年度 DBMS。计算结果基于当前(2019年1月)分数和2018年1月的分数差值获得,最终的结果代表了一个产品在 2018 年获得的人气。DB-Engines 表示之所以采用分数而不是百分比作为评估的维度,是为了照顾在开始时受欢迎程
一、简介NoSQLNoSQL,指的是非关系型的数据库。NoSQL有时也称作Not Only SQL的缩写,对不同于传统的关系型数据库数据库管理系统的统称。NoSQL用于超大规模数据的存储。(例如谷歌或Facebook每天为他们的用户收集万亿比特的数据)。这些类型的数据存储不需要固定的模式,无需多余操作就可以横向扩展。MongoDBMongoDB 一个基于分布式文件存储的数据库。由 C++ 语
转载 2023-11-06 20:30:39
55阅读
安装MongoDBhttps://docs.mongodb.com/guides/server/install/ 参考 基本使用mongodb数据库的命令 查看当前的数据库:db 查看所有的数据库:show dbs /show databases 切换数据库:use db_name 删除当前的数据库:db.dropDatabase() mongodb集合的命令
一、应用场景MongoDB 由C++语言编写的,一个基于分布式文件存储的开源数据库系统。在高负载的情况下,添加更多的节点,可以保证服务器性能。1、网站数据MongoDB 非常适合实时的插入,更新与查询,并具备网站实时数据存储所需的复制及高度伸缩性。2、缓存:适合作为信息基础设施的缓存层。在系统重启之后,由mongodb搭建的持久化缓存可以避免下层的数据源过载。3、大尺寸、低价值的数据。4、重
转载 2023-07-31 10:56:18
82阅读
    前段时间接触了NoSql类型的数据库redis,当时作为缓存server使用的。那么从这篇博客開始学习还有一个非常出名的NoSql数据库MongoDb。只是眼下还没有在开发其中使用。一步一步来吧。 简单介绍     MongoDB一个开源的,基于分布式的,面向文档存储的非关系型数据库。 是非关系型数据库其中功能最丰富、最像关系数
MongoDB不是关系型数据库,因此也就没有了表,行等概念,但是有一些类似的概念,主要有 数据库(Database),集合(Collection),文档(Document),其中数据库跟关系型数据库数据库一个概念,集合相当于表,文档相当于行。下面分别来介绍这些概念。 1. 文档:文档MongoDB的核心概念,也是MongoDB数据的基本单元。所谓文档就是多个键及其关联的值有序的放
    适合读者: 对于MongoDB目前尚未有整体认识的初学者。在这里本ID将作一个简要的介绍:二、MongoDB简介MongoDB一个高性能,开源,无模式的文档型数据库当前NoSql数据库中比较热门的一种。它在许多场景下可用于替代传统的关系型数据库或键/值存储方式。Mongo使用C++开发。Mongo的官方网站地址:://.mongodb.org/,
转载 2024-01-04 09:36:55
40阅读
1- NoSQL简介 NoSQL(NoSQL = Not Only SQL ),意即"不仅仅是SQL";NoSQL指非关系型的数据库,有时也称作Not Only SQL的缩写,即"不仅仅是SQL",对非传统关系型数据库管理系统的统称;NoSQL用于超大规模数据的存储(数据存储不需要固定的模式,无需多余操作就可以横向扩展); 2- MongoDB简介 HomePage:
  • 1
  • 2
  • 3
  • 4
  • 5